Daylight hours in Corona
Corona gets 14h 24m of daylight on its longest day in June, and 9h 55m on its shortest in December — a difference of 4h 29m across the year.
How fast the days change
Around 17 March, Corona gains or loses about 2.1 minutes of daylight every day.
Enough to notice over a fortnight, though the seasons arrive more gently here than further from the equator.
Sunrise and sunset by month
On the 15th of each month, in America/Los_Angeles local time, daylight saving included.
| Month | Sunrise | Sunset | Daylight | Solar noon |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| January | 06:55 | 17:04 | 10h 09m | 11:59 |
| February | 06:34 | 17:34 | 11h 00m | 12:04 |
| March | 07:00 | 18:57 | 11h 58m | 12:59 |
| April | 06:18 | 19:21 | 13h 02m | 12:50 |
| May | 05:48 | 19:44 | 13h 56m | 12:46 |
| June | 05:38 | 20:02 | 14h 24m | 12:50 |
| July | 05:50 | 20:01 | 14h 11m | 12:56 |
| August | 06:12 | 19:37 | 13h 25m | 12:54 |
| September | 06:33 | 18:56 | 12h 23m | 12:45 |
| October | 06:55 | 18:16 | 11h 21m | 12:35 |
| November | 06:22 | 16:46 | 10h 24m | 11:34 |
| December | 06:48 | 16:42 | 9h 55m | 11:45 |
Solstices and equinoxes
| Date | Sunrise | Sunset | Daylight |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| March equinox | 20 Mar | 06:53 | 19:01 | 12h 08m |
| June solstice | 21 Jun | 05:39 | 20:04 | 14h 25m |
| September equinox | 22 Sep | 06:38 | 18:47 | 12h 08m |
| December solstice | 21 Dec | 06:51 | 16:45 | 9h 54m |
The equinoxes give almost exactly twelve hours of daylight everywhere on earth — "almost" because sunrise is defined by the sun's upper edge rather than its centre, and the atmosphere bends its light over the horizon before it has really arrived. Both lengthen the day by a few minutes.

Assumptions
- Sea-level horizon. Hills, mountains and buildings all delay sunrise and bring sunset forward, sometimes by a lot in a valley.
- Standard refraction. Sunrise is taken at −0.833°, allowing for the sun's disc and average atmospheric bending. Unusual air conditions shift it by a minute or two.
- Local clock time, with daylight saving applied from the IANA timezone database.
